However, when the application was denied, the statue was then moved to Detroit for its unveiling. Christian News Network reports the statue was presented by the Satanic Temple, a Satan-worshipping group that has a significant following, about 200 of whom are in Detroit. The initial plan was to have the statue, which depicts a winged, goat-headed Satan on a throne next to two children, erected alongside a monument depicting the Ten Commandments in Oklahoma's State Capitol grounds. Over 100 protestors gathered to voice their concerns against it and the statue itself has received widespread media attention. The nine-foot tall statue was, as you'd expect, met with protest in Detroit when it was unveiled. America's constitution expressly espouses a clear separation between church and state Satanists believe laws that allow for religious monuments on government property is a mockery of this. The statue was initially scheduled to be erected in the city which passed a law allowing religious monuments to be erected on government property. The Satanic Temple of Detroit has recently unveiled a bronze, nine-foot statue of Old Nick in Detroit, Michigan that it's called "a celebration of a group effort" on their part. The statue was to be unveiled at Berts Marketplace in Detroits Eastern Market district, but Bert Dearing said he gave the group back its 3,000 rental fee when he learned who booked the place.
